The pitch is the perspective of which the roof rises from its most affordable to highest point. Most US home structures, except in very dried regions, has roofs that are sloped, or pitched. Although modern engineering elements such as drainpipes may take away the need for pitch, roofs are pitched for reasons of custom and looks. So the pitch is partly dependent after stylistic factors, and partially regarding practicalities. Other types of roofing, for example pantiles, are unstable over a steeply pitched roof but provide excellent weather protection at a comparatively low angle. In parts where there is little rainwater, an almost even roof with a slight run-off provides satisfactory protection against an intermittent downpour. For all those that not, extra insulation is installed under the external coating often. In developed countries, the majority of dwellings have a ceiling installed under the structural members of the roof. Ice dams take place when high temperature escapes through the uppermost area of the roof, and the snow at those details melts, refreezing as it drips over the shingles, and collecting by means of ice at the lower points. This can lead to structural harm from stress, including the damage of drainage and gutter systems.
